Notes: One of the social projects I’ve had the privilege to be involved with is a remarkable organisation called PeaceJam. They get young people (participants) to meet Nobel Peace Prize winners up close and get engaged in taking positive action to change the world (at both a local and global level yo). Watching young people actually BE the change was frrssshhh. I feel like it’s renewed my faith that good stuff can actually happen right now! | So after one PeaceJam event I just went home and stuck the word “Participant” on my wall. | The day I wrote the song I woke up and felt really lethargic. Then I looked up and saw the note. Nice. This track was performed, written and produced in my bedroom and vocals were recorded through a laptop mic.

Homecut Leeds

Homecut is the brainchild of MC/producer Testament. Conscious lyricism, live instrumentation and mix of Soul, Hip-Hop and sonic experimentation mark out Homecut on the UK landscape. The critically acclaimed debut album “NO FREEDOM WITHOUT SACRIFICE” features collaborations with Corinne Bailey Rae, Soweto Kinch, US rap legend J-Live, Andreya Triana and members of the Cinematic Orchesta. ... more
